Gluten Free Apple Cinnamon French Toast Vegan Allergy Free Instructions. in a bowl, add the vegan milk, maple syrup (optional), flax meal, vanilla extract and cinnamon. whisk together vigorously and place in your freezer for the batter to set up and get thicker for 15 minutes. when the batter is thicker, whisk again. Heat a pan on medium heat. add some vegan butter or oil to the pan. i use about a tablespoon of butter and add more butter while cooking additional slices. a non stick or cast iron pan works best for this recipe. working with 2 bread slices at a time, dip each slice into the mixture on both sides. Dip each side of the bread in the batter and let soak for about 10 seconds, then add the bread to the pan and cook for 2 3 minutes on each side, until golden brown. add more vegan butter oil to the pan as needed in between pieces of bread. serve with maple syrup, powdered sugar and fresh fruit, if desired.
